Youth League: St. Andrews maintain hundred percent record in Section A

St. Andrews maintained their hundred percent record with a third win in three matches as they defeated Floriana 1-0 in the Youth League Section A.

Birkirkara joined them on top with nine points as the beat Pietà Hotspurs 2-1 but the Saints have a game in hand.

Valletta and Pietà are third on seven points, followed by Melita on 5, Floriana, Hibs and Qormi on 3, St. Patrick 1 and Attard 0.

After winning the first five matches, Section B leaders Hamrun Spartans suffered their first defeat on Monday as they lost to Rabat Ajax 0-1. The Magpies are still unbeaten with three wins and three draws from six matches and are currently second on 12 points.

Marsaxlokk are third on 11 points, followed by Sliema on 9, Balzan and Naxxar 8, San Gwann and Mosta 7, Msida 3 and Mgarr 0.

Section C leaders St. Venera Lightnings also suffered the first defeat as they lost to Zebbug Rangers by the odd goal in five. Zebbug move on the 14-point mark, one point behind the Lightnings.

Pembroke are third on 11 points, followed by Senglea and Gudja on 10, Siggiewi and Lija 6, Mellieha 5, Tarxien 4 and Zurrieq 1.

Four teams share the top spot in Section D as Zejtun Corithians, Dingli Swallows, Vittoriosa Stars and Mqabba lead the way on 13 points with four wins and a draw.

Birzebbuga St. Peter’s are fifth on 10, followed by Gzira and Sirens on 9, Marsa 8, Ghaxaq and St. George’s 5, Mtarfa, Kalkara and Santa Lucia 4, Fgura and Kirkop 3 and Xghajra 0.
